SIMULTANEOUS RP-HPLC DETERMINATION OF ARMODAFINIL, CLONIDINE, AND VILOXAZINEHYDROCHLORIDE: ICH VALIDATION AND COMPUTATIONAL GREEN, BLUE, AND WHITE METRIC PROFILING
Attention-deficit/hyperactivity disorder (ADHD) is a widespread neurological condition commonly managed withacombination of armodafinil, clonidine, and viloxazine hydrochloride. Despite their concurrent clinical use, novalidated simultaneous analytical method exists for their quantification, representing a critical gap in pharmaceutical quality control. This study presents the development and ICH Q2(R1) validation of an environmentally sustainablereverse-phase high-performance liquid chromatography (RP-HPLC) method. A sustainable RP-HPLCmethodwasdeveloped for the simultaneous determination of three drugs in a single analytical run. Chromatographic separationwas performed on a Sunfire C18 column using a Waters 2695D system with UV detection at 230 nm. Separationwas conducted at a flow rate of 1.0 mL/min with an injection volume of 10 μL. The 14-minute run yielded wellresolved peaks with excellent linearity (R² > 0.99). Intraday and interday RSDs remained below 2%, confirminghigh precision and accuracy, while low LOD and LOQ values demonstrated adequate sensitivity, and robustness andsolution stability studies further validated its reliability for routine use. Comprehensive sustainability evaluationusing AGREE prep, AGREE, GAPI, GWAPE, WAC, and BAGI tools revealed superior greenness, blueness, andwhiteness scores compared to previously reported individual methods, demonstrating reduced solvent hazards, minimised waste generation, and enhanced analytical efficiency. The proposed method provides a scientificallyvalid, economical and eco-compatible solution to the simultaneous pharmaceutical quality check analysis, withdirect applicability to regulatory submissions and industrial laboratory workflows. Its green analytical profile further positions it as a model for sustainable method development in multi-drug formulation analysis.
